What is a Railroad Settlement?
A railroad settlement occurs when an individual who has actually been hurt in an occurrence involving a train or within railroad property pertains to an agreement with the railroad company, generally to fix an individual injury claim without continuing to trial. These settlements can cover a wide array of situations, consisting of train accidents, slip and fall incidents on railway property, and direct exposure to harmful products.

The settlement process in railroad cases often follows a structured format. Below is a detailed outline highlighting the key phases:
Initial Consultation: The hurt party contacts a legal agent to assess the case's viability based on proof and liability.Investigation and Evidence Gathering: The attorney conducts an examination, collects evidence, and interviews witnesses to build a case.Filing Claims: Based on preliminary findings, a claim is filed with the railroad company, detailed in a need letter laying out the claim's specifics.Settlement: The railroad's insurer will evaluate the claim and may propose a counter-offer. This is where settlements come into play.Resolution: If both celebrations settle on the terms, a settlement agreement is reached, and compensation is often paid. If negotiations fail, litigation might end up being essential.Elements Influencing Railroad Settlement Amounts

The length of time does the settlement process take?
The period can vary based on various aspects, including the complexity of the case and the desire of both parties to work out, however settlements often take a number of weeks to months.
2. Are railroad settlements taxable?
In basic, accident settlements are non-taxable, however punitive damages or interest on settlements may be based on tax. Always seek advice from a tax expert for personalized assistance.
3. Can I still sue if I was partly at fault?
Yes, many states follow a comparative neglect guideline, allowing you to recuperate damages even if you bear some obligation for the accident.
